What problem does it solve?

This Skill enables teams to systematically capture project work logs and determine when those experiences should be reflected in the resume, ensuring consistent career storytelling.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Structured work-log entries: per-project logs with a defined template to capture background, actions, and outcomes.
  • Single Source of Truth (SSOT): a centralized repository of work data that can feed resume documents (resume.md) and career_portfolio.md.
  • Decision workflow: a clear process to decide whether a log should be reflected in the resume or kept as part of the work-history logs.

Quick Start

Create a new work-log file under docs/career/work-logs/{company}/{YYYY-MM-DD}-{log-name}.md using the provided template, fill in the sections, and then run the resume reflection decision step to determine if it should update the resume.
